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6413133124 364088 46384
73950 78850736
73950 78850736
43 447623 63984009 67
All about undefined
Interested in learning more?
73950 78850736
43 447623 63984009 67
See more
09 05451763688
6055 35006 025 477112
See more
2405124 692
019961 3285268 74 083205779 001609
See more